Solution for 2(-u-15)=-8 equation:


Simplifying
2(-1u + -15) = -8

Reorder the terms:
2(-15 + -1u) = -8
(-15 * 2 + -1u * 2) = -8
(-30 + -2u) = -8

Solving
-30 + -2u = -8

Solving for variable 'u'.

Move all terms containing u to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'30' to each side of the equation.
-30 + 30 + -2u = -8 + 30

Combine like terms: -30 + 30 = 0
0 + -2u = -8 + 30
-2u = -8 + 30

Combine like terms: -8 + 30 = 22
-2u = 22

Divide each side by '-2'.
u = -11

Simplifying
u = -11
